Anterior Cruciate Ligament Injuries Clinical Trial
Official title:
Effect of Multiple Instrumentation in Transportal and Transtibial Techniques for ACL Reconstruction Regarding Bacterial Contamination: A Randomized Control Study

To determine the Effect of multiple instrumentation regarding bacterial contamination in transportal and transtibial techniques in ACL reconstruction .A Randomized controlled study
| Status | Completed |
| Enrollment | 80 |
| Est. completion date | March 30, 2022 |
| Est. primary completion date | September 30, 2021 |
| Accepts healthy volunteers | No |
| Gender | All |
| Age group | 18 Years to 40 Years |
| Eligibility | Inclusion Criteria: 1. Isolated ACL Injury. 2. Non deformed knee. Exclusion Criteria: 1. Associated knee injury (eg. PCL). 2. Deformed knee ( eg. genu varus , genu valgus more than 4 degree ) 3. patient with medical history of being immune compromized patient eg,DM |
